  • TDR Targets ID: 66636
  • Name: 1-[6-[2-(azocan-1-yl)ethoxy]-4,7-dimethoxy-1- benzofuran-5-yl]-3-methylurea
  • MW: 405.488 | Formula: C21H31N3O5
  • H donors: 2 H acceptors: 1 LogP: 3.03 Rotable bonds: 9
    Rule of 5 violations (Lipinski): 1
  • SMILES: CNC(=O)Nc1c(OCCN2CCCCCCC2)c(OC)c2c(c1OC)cco2
  • InChi: 1S/C21H31N3O5/c1-22-21(25)23-16-17(26-2)15-9-13-28-18(15)20(27-3)19(16)29-14-12-24-10-7-5-4-6-8-11-24/h9,13H,4-8,10-12,14H2,1-3H3,(H2,22,23,25)
  • InChiKey: LLLSULFNTQYVIA-UHFFFAOYSA-N

Activities

Activity type Activity value Assay description Source Reference
Duration (functional) = 30 min Duration for the sinus rhythm recovery was measured ChEMBL. 7205883
ISC (functional) 0 % Activity against harris coronary ligation induced ventricular arrhythmia was measured as percent of initial sinus complexes after dose 2mg/kg,iv; Inactive ChEMBL. 7205883
LD50 (ADMET) = 14 mg kg-1 Toxicity estimated in mouse as LD50 by intravenous administration ChEMBL. 7205883
LD50 (ADMET) = 14 mg kg-1 Toxicity estimated in mouse as LD50 by intravenous administration ChEMBL. 7205883
SRR (functional) = 100 % Activity against ouabain-induced ventricular arrhythmia of the compound was measured as percent of sinus rhythm recovery at dose of 2 mg/kg iv ChEMBL. 7205883
